    Peloton Tread: Exactly what I needed
    Initial reaction: This treadmill is exactly what I was looking for: solid, professional quality construction, simple and obvious controls, and great programming to make training more productive and enjoyable.Compared to consumer-grade treadmills, this Peloton Tread is like a Harley versus a Honda: both might get you where you need to go, but the Peleton will do it with more style and grace. The speed and incline controls are simple and straightforward, and very precise: control your speed in .1 mph increments, incline .1% at a time. The oversize high-res video screen’s viewing angle can be adjusted easily and stays in place where you put it – if you’ve ever wrestled with one that was fixed in place, or 1990’s era resolution, or flopped around, you know how much that matters.The deck feels solid and belt movement is smooth, although I will need a lot more miles to know whether that’s true at speed and distance.My Amazon delivery included setup and placement – a good idea since the assembled unit weighs 400+ pounds. It took the delivery and assembly team about an hour to put it together, test and calibrate, and make sure everything worked as expected.This is a significant purchase, and you can buy treadmills for less money… But the old adage “you get what you pay for” is clearly a factor with this Peloton Tread. It’s a good size – not small, but space-efficient; it’s quiet; and sturdy enough that I expect years of good performance. Highly recommended.90 day update: no corrections to post, everything written above is still good, and I am very happy with the Tread purchase. I have noticed a couple things that might be worth sharing; they’re probably not going to change your decision, but hopefully will inspire Peloton to further improve the product:- I’m a “miles, not metric” old person – but the Peloton engineers think meters matter more than miles… So laps while running are counted in meters and over the course of a workout, the “miles” counter is accurate but doesn’t sync with the graphic depiction of laps on a track. Easily fixed, but sloppy programming as is.- I appreciate the ability to “cast” the treadmill screen to the (non-existent) TV in my workout space; I would appreciate the ability to cast from my phone TO the treadmill screen even more. Why? Because I like to watch sporting events while I’m working out, but Peloton doesn’t (yet) support integration of any of the league pass apps I use, so I am forced to use an iPad for this content. Not a terrible hardship but an unnecessary waste of the otherwise great screen that would be even more useful if it could be used to watch MY preferred content.I will post a further update if and when Peloton delivers these software updates…

    Easy Delivery and install
    I generally don’t write reviews, but realizing how much I actually read and rely on them (especially for larger ticket items that I don’t want to return) I felt I needed to take a few minutes to write up my experience so far. A little payback for everyone else helping me on other items in the past.First thing first, delivery and set-up were easy. Mainly because I didn’t have to do it. I scheduled a time slot, tracked the truck in real-time through Amazon so I knew when they were arriving, a big truck pulled up, two guys carried it into my house and installed it. Simple as that. And I’m glad they did and not me, because this is not a lightweight machine. The box just for the tread said it was 275 pounds. But it is solid. It doesn’t wobble or shake at any speed that I’ve tried.I was up and running within 30 minutes. Every part of it so far is high quality. The screen is huge and is a touchscreen so it is really easy to use and navigate while running or walking. And it has access to lots of TV content as well as the classes. I had my 81 year old mom try it out and she was excited she could watch Netflix while she went for a walk.One of my surprise favorite parts are the controls for the speed and incline. They are nobs on the handrails and not up and down buttons. You just lightly turn them to increase of decrease. I played the Peloton game built into the system called Lanebreak to practice using them and they are pretty intuitive to use and much easier than the buttons I’ve used in the past for other treadmills or ellipticals.All in all I am a big fan so far.
